Face ID Issue on iPhone 16 Pro Max

Hello everyone,

I purchased an iPhone 16 Pro Max two months ago. Today, I encountered an issue where I received a message stating:

"Face ID has been detected with a problem."

I updated my phone to the latest iOS version, but the issue was not resolved. I even performed a factory reset and set up the device as new, yet the Face ID still does not work.

The phone has never been dropped, scratched, or damaged in any way.

In this case, do Apple specialists repair the device or replace it?

Stuff happens. That’s what warranties are for; contact Apple support. If it is a hardware issue they will replace the iPhone with either a new or an Apple refurbished at their option.


Best way: 

  • Install the Apple Support app on your iPhone or iPad - you can contact support directly from the app, and the tech will have (with your permission) access to diagnostic data on your device
